Output 66a562af8027f1dd8cbb240249c38a16478f74cea125ec4777d0b421520e5eff:0

value
5381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e784af0f057933844896d04a77a784a49dbe03 OP_EQUAL
address
34nHa3hfF44oSmV6vE1X9azPRsfu6oUyPD
transaction
66a562af8027f1dd8cbb240249c38a16478f74cea125ec4777d0b421520e5eff